Detailed Engineering Specifications

Trusted by engineers across multiple sectors, this 304 stainless steel stock sheet boasts a substantial 0.266" thickness, a 16" width, and a 32" length, providing ample material for fabrication. Its inherent properties, including excellent tensile strength and resistance to pitting and crevice corrosion in diverse environments, make it a prime choice for components used in marine, chemical processing, and food service industries where hygiene and durability are paramount. The austenitic structure ensures good formability and weldability, facilitating integration into complex assemblies.

Mechanical Properties

Tensile Strength75,000 psi (515 MPa)
Yield Strength30,000 psi (205 MPa)
Elongation in 2 in.40% min
HardnessRockwell B95 max

Chemical Composition

Carbon (C)0.08% max
Chromium (Cr)18.0 - 20.0%
Nickel (Ni)8.0 - 10.5%
Manganese (Mn)2.00% max
